Key Steps in the MLAT Request Lifecycle

The key steps in the MLAT request lifecycle begin with the initiation and drafting of the request. This phase involves precise documentation of the investigative needs, including relevant legal references and detailed descriptions of evidence sought. Accuracy at this stage is vital to ensure subsequent processing proceeds smoothly.

Next is the transmission and acknowledgment phase, where the request is securely sent through established channels to the requesting or requested jurisdiction. Upon receipt, the receiving authority typically provides an acknowledgment, confirming that the request is understood and queued for action, which helps prevent delays.

The evidence collection and transfer stage follows, during which authorities gather, examine, and securely transfer the requested evidence or information. This process must adhere strictly to legal and procedural standards to uphold integrity and confidentiality, often involving secure electronic transmission systems.

Finally, the process concludes with the finalization and return of results. Authorities compile the evidence or information according to the original request, verify completeness, and transmit the findings back to the requesting jurisdiction. Proper documentation and reporting are essential to maintain transparency and legal compliance throughout the MLAT request lifecycle.

Transmission and acknowledgment

Efficient transmission and acknowledgment are vital components of streamlining MLAT request processes. This phase ensures that requests are accurately and promptly communicated between jurisdictions to facilitate timely cooperation. Clear protocols and secure channels are essential to achieve this goal.

The transmission process typically involves sending a formal request via secure electronic systems or diplomatic channels. A standardized format or template can help minimize errors and improve clarity. Confirmation of receipt, or acknowledgment, is then issued by the receiving authority, confirming that the request has been received and is being processed.

Key steps include:

  1. Sending the request through a secure, mutually agreed communication system.
  2. Obtaining an acknowledgment from the receiving authority, confirming receipt.
  3. Tracking the request status to prevent delays.
  4. Keeping records of transmissions and acknowledgments for accountability.

These steps enhance transparency and reduce the risk of miscommunication, directly contributing to the efficiency of the MLAT request process.

Evidence collection and transfer

Evidence collection and transfer are vital components in the MLAT request process, ensuring the integrity and admissibility of digital or physical evidence. Accurate collection involves adhering to legal standards to maintain chain of custody, preventing contamination or tampering. Proper documentation during collection is essential for transparency and evidentiary value.

The transfer phase requires secure methods to prevent unauthorized access or loss of sensitive data. Utilizing encrypted electronic transmission systems, such as secure file transfer protocols or dedicated government networks, enhances confidentiality. Clear procedures for documentation, acknowledgment, and receipt confirmation are crucial to streamline the process and avoid delays.

In some cases, evidence transfer may involve physical shipping, which demands strict packaging standards and customs compliance. Given the importance of speed and security, technological innovations like blockchain-based tracking and automated audit trails are increasingly adopted to facilitate efficient evidence transfer in MLAT requests.

Clear jurisdictional guidelines

Clear jurisdictional guidelines are critical to the efficiency of MLAT request processes by delineating the responsibilities and authorities of each participating country. These guidelines help prevent delays caused by jurisdictional ambiguities or overlaps, ensuring smooth cooperation across borders.

To establish effective jurisdictional guidelines, authorities should consider:

  1. Scope of request – Clearly defining which country has authority over particular legal matters or jurisdictions.
  2. Legal eligibility – Clarifying the legal parameters under which evidence can be shared or requests can be processed.
  3. Documentation standards – Ensuring requests specify jurisdictional identifiers to facilitate swift recognition.
  4. Procedural compliance – Outlining procedures for jurisdictional disputes and escalation pathways.

Implementing these guidelines improves coordination, reduces processing times, and enhances compliance within the MLAT framework. Precise jurisdictional delineation thus plays a vital role in streamlining MLAT request processes and reinforcing international legal cooperation.

Role of International Cooperation and Multilateral Efforts

International cooperation and multilateral efforts are vital in enhancing the efficiency of MLAT request processes. These collaborations facilitate faster exchange of information, reducing delays caused by jurisdictional differences. They also promote standardized procedures, ensuring consistency across borders.

Multilateral agreements, such as the Council of Europe Convention on Cybercrime or the Budapest Convention, provide legal frameworks that encourage mutual assistance and data sharing. These frameworks streamline processes and foster trust among signatory nations.

Efforts like joint task forces and international task forces enable law enforcement agencies from multiple jurisdictions to coordinate investigations effectively. Such cooperation helps overcome legal and procedural barriers, expediting evidence gathering and data transfer. However, these efforts rely heavily on clear communication and adherence to international standards.

Overall, international collaboration plays an instrumental role in overcoming procedural obstacles, promoting best practices, and ensuring the swift and secure exchange of information in MLAT requests. This cooperation ultimately strengthens global efforts against transnational crime.
